"The Magic of Things: Still-Life Painting 1500-1800" is a 368-page hardcover book published in 2008 by Hatje Cantz Verlag Gmbh & Co KG. Authored by Jochen Sander, the book explores the art of still-life painting from the Renaissance period. It features illustrations and showcases collections, catalogs, and exhibitions from various museums such as the Städel Museum Frankfurt, Kunstmuseum Basel, and Hessisches Landesmuseum Darmstadt. This comprehensive volume is a valuable resource for art enthusiasts looking to delve into the history and beauty of still-life painting during the 16th to 18th centuries.
